Myer sell Wagga Wagga carpark for $1.15 million

Katherine JimenezDecember 3, 2013

Department store chain Myer has sold auction its carpark in Wagga Wagga in south-west of NSW for $1.15 million. 

The 2,036 square metres vacant land, at 152 Tarcutta Street, was acquired by a local group of investors.

The property accommodates about 65 cars and is currently used as overflow and staff car parking for the Myer Department Store in Wagga Wagga.

The sale was negotiated by Wagga Wagga principal at Knight Frank, Jill Toohey and colleague Scott Turner.
